After further investigation, I've narrowed down the issue. It seems that the conftest (checking for stack setup via sigaltstack) hangs when executing from a gnome-terminal (pts/0). From a console (tty2), it works fine, (even though Gnome is still running in the background). Anyone have any ideas on why this would be the case.
